What is the latitude and longitude code of Rouen Airport? The latitude of Rouen Airport is 49.3842010498, and the longitude is 1.1748000383. Geographic coordinates are a way of specifying the location of a place on Earth, using a pair of numbers to represent a latitude and longitude.
